Essential Items for Physical Recovery
When someone is recovering from a physical ailment, comfort and convenience are crucial. Consider including the following items in your care package:
- Comfortable Clothing: Soft pajamas or cozy socks can make resting more enjoyable.
- Nourishing Snacks: Healthy snacks like nuts, dried fruits, or protein bars provide energy and nutrients.
- Hydration Helpers: A reusable water bottle or herbal teas can encourage sufficient fluid intake.
These items can significantly improve the day-to-day experience of someone focused on healing their body. Consider their dietary restrictions or preferences when selecting snacks to ensure they are both delicious and suitable.
Mental and Emotional Support
Recovery isn't just physical; emotional well-being is equally important. Providing mental and emotional support through your care package can be incredibly impactful:
- Inspirational Books: Uplifting novels or self-help books can be great companions during recovery.
- Journals and Pens: Encourage them to jot down thoughts or gratitude lists to promote positivity.
- Relaxation Aids: Items like scented candles or essential oils can help create a calming atmosphere.

Adding a Personal Touch
A personal touch can transform a care package from thoughtful to unforgettable. Here are some ideas to personalize your package:
- Handwritten Notes: Include a heartfelt letter expressing your thoughts and well wishes.
- Photos: Add printed photos of shared memories to evoke smiles and warmth.
- Custom Playlists: Curate a playlist of songs that hold special meaning or are simply uplifting.
These personal elements show that you have put thought and care into the package, making it even more meaningful for the recipient.
Considerations for Unique Needs
Every recovery journey is unique. Tailor your care package to meet the specific needs of the recipient. For example, if they are recovering from surgery, they may appreciate items like a neck pillow or soothing lotion for sensitive skin. If they are dealing with emotional recovery, consider including uplifting podcasts or guided meditation recordings.

By taking into account individual preferences and circumstances, your care package will not only be thoughtful but also truly supportive in their recovery process.
Packing and Presentation Tips
The presentation of your care package is just as important as its contents. Consider these tips for an appealing package:
- Select a Theme: Choose colors or motifs that resonate with the recipient's tastes.
- Use Eco-Friendly Materials: Opt for recyclable packaging materials to show care for the environment.
- Add a Surprise Element: Include a small, unexpected gift for an extra touch of joy.
A beautifully presented care package enhances the unboxing experience, making it all the more special for your loved one.
Delivery Options and Timing
The timing of your care package delivery can make a big difference. If you're mailing it, consider using expedited shipping to ensure it arrives promptly. If you’re delivering it in person, coordinate with a time that suits them best, keeping in mind their rest schedule.
If you're unable to deliver physically due to distance, many online services offer pre-made care packages with customizable options. These services can be a convenient alternative while still allowing you to add personal touches through notes or selected items.
